Year 13 A level music student Mia Holt represented Abraham Darby in the 2nd Young Musician Competition held at Haberdashers’ Hall in London. She was one of ten competitors playing advanced level repertoire to a live audience which included three highly qualified judges. Mia, who has grade 8 distinction on both clarinet & baritone saxophone played Nigel Wood’s ‘Schwarzer Tanzer’ which is a lively Latin American style number.
